- Stand between the two anchored bands, grasp them with an overhand grip, and position the bands at shoulder level.
- Brace your core and push the bands overhead, fully extending your arms.
- Lower the bands back to shoulder level, keeping your core engaged and arms straight. Repeat for desired number of reps.
- Start by standing between the two anchored bands with your feet shoulder-width apart and the bands positioned at a high point.
- Grasp the ends of each band with your hands, keeping your palms facing each other.
- Keeping your arms slightly bent and your back straight, slowly pull the bands away from your body until your arms are extended straight out to the sides. Hold for a second, then slowly release back to the starting position. Repeat for desired reps.
